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Practical Metal Polishing - Typically, the polishing of metal is necessary for appearance or clean-room usages. It is among the most favored procedures because of its use in intensifying the original beauty of the items, for example, motorbike parts, cookware or auto parts. In addition, a lot of clean-rooms want a shiny finish in an effort to lower the penetrability of the metal surfaces which can cause debris to collect and contaminate. A good illustration of this usage could be in vacuum chambers. There are several ways to finish metals, and we'll have a look at some of the procedures involved. Various metals may be burnished manually, with purpose built bu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A buffing paste or compound is generally put into use, which will contain dolomite, aluminum oxide, tripoli, chromium oxide, limestone, chalk,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, because of its below average thermal conductivity, reasonably high viscidness, and hardness is considered the most time intensive. In contrast, products made out of non-ferrous metals tend to be more receptive to buffing, as these call for the minimum amount of processes.
Whenever a greater processing quality is not called for, swifter pad speeds can be used. A slower pad speed is required if a high quality mirror finish is required. Polishing buffs plastered with compound can be greatly affected by the load on the surface of the pad. The level of the surface pressure might be amplified to a specified extent, however further exceeding the perfect amount of pressure not simply reduces the quality level of the procedure, but in addition decreases the level of performance, can bring about wear to the part, and in addition a conspicuous heating of the work-pieces, caused by friction. For thinner material, it will be elevated heat (and a corresponding pliability of the metal) that can induce elements to flex, warp or bend. On the whole, it needs an expert polisher to add in every one of these things to both prevent damage to the metal part and to deliver the results correctly. To substantially increase the quality of the resulting surface, the buffing operation needs to be carried out with less power and not a large amount of force in an effort to eventually produce a surface area devoid of scratches or fine lines brought about by the finishing process, thereby 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
